This prospective observational study evaluates the safety and effectiveness of stereotactic body radiotherapy (SBRT) for liver tumors, liver metastases, and pancreatic tumors. The study focuses on systematic monitoring and optimization of the SBRT treatment process, including adherence to the implemented protocol, with the aim of simplifying methods while maintaining treatment safety.
Stereotactic body radiotherapy (SBRT) is an advanced radiotherapy technique that enables delivery of high radiation doses to tumors with high precision while limiting exposure of surrounding healthy tissues. This study prospectively follows patients treated with SBRT for primary liver tumors, liver metastases, and pancreatic tumors at the Institute of Oncology Ljubljana.
The primary aim is to monitor and optimize all steps of the SBRT workflow, including protocol adherence, in order to ensure safe implementation and to evaluate treatment outcomes. The study also aims to assess whether the established SBRT protocol can be simplified without compromising patient safety.
Treatment safety and effectiveness outcomes will be evaluated during follow-up, and the collected data will be used to support further refinement of SBRT procedures for upper gastrointestinal tumors
